Привет! У меня вопрос!!!!
Что у тебя означает clrscr() getch()
Это яз с++ ?
Привет. Это и в Turbo C есть. clrscr() очищает экран. getch() ждет пока ты нажмешь какую-нибудь кнопку.
Форум групп 22475 и 22478 ЕФ КГТУ |
Привет, Гость! Войдите или зарегистрируйтесь.
Вы здесь » Форум групп 22475 и 22478 ЕФ КГТУ » Учеба » ПнаЯВУ (C)
Привет! У меня вопрос!!!!
Что у тебя означает clrscr() getch()
Это яз с++ ?
Привет. Это и в Turbo C есть. clrscr() очищает экран. getch() ждет пока ты нажмешь какую-нибудь кнопку.
Я документацию в Си к этому оператору просто не нашел. А вот в С++ докопался, clrscr() в программе очищает строку и переносит курсор в левую верхнюю часть экрана.
Вот и с дуру запутался
Отредактировано Рентик (2010-01-23 19:50:09)
Листинг MASSIV5
#include<stdio.h>
#include<math.h>
#include<conio.h>
main()
{
int i,p,q,r,d[100];
q=-1,r=0;
clrscr();
for (i=0;i<20;i++)
{
d[i]=rand()-rand();
printf("%8d",d[i]);
}
printf("\n");
for(i=0;i<20;i++)
p=d[0];
if (p>0)
q=1;
for (i=1;i<20;i++)
if (d[i]*q>0)
p=d[i];
else
{
p=d[i];
r=r+1;
q=q*(-1);
}
printf("Znak menjalsja %d raz(a)",r);
getch();
return 0;
}

Я уже выкладывал с первую по седьмую решенные
Я уже выкладывал с первую по седьмую решенные
они в в ТС работают?
У меня да. Но проверь еще раз, ато вдруг ошибки есть. У меня это давно лежит. Опять заметит, что ошибки у всех одинаковые и станет топить.
15й ( вырезка )
int sum[n];
for (int i=0; i<n; i++)
{
sum[i]=0;
for (int j=0; j<m; j++)
if (a[i][j]<0)
sum[i]+=a[i][j];
У меня да. Но проверь еще раз, ато вдруг ошибки есть. У меня это давно лежит. Опять заметит, что ошибки у всех одинаковые и станет топить.
интересно в какой среде они у тебя работают, у меня ни одна не пошла ну 4 еще можно запустить, а 3 заного делать или исправлять ошибки, а там их.
15й ( вырезка )
int sum[n];for (int i=0; i<n; i++){ sum[i]=0; for (int j=0; j<m; j++) if (a[i][j]<0) sum[i]+=a[i][j];
Всем было сказано что выкладываем полные листинги и рабочие на 100%
Ща проверим
Вы здесь » Форум групп 22475 и 22478 ЕФ КГТУ » Учеба » ПнаЯВУ (C)